Brevianamides are a class of indole alkaloids produced as secondary metabolites of fungi in the genus Penicillium and Aspergillus. Structurally similar to paraherquamides they are a small class compounds that contain a bicyclo[2.2.2]diazoctane ring system. One of the major secondary metabolites in Penicillium spores they are responsible for inflammatory response in lung cells.
